FBND vs. JEPQ
FBND (Fidelity Total Bond ETF) and JEPQ (JPMorgan Nasdaq Equity Premium Income 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- FBND is a Intermediate Core-Plus Bond fund actively managed by Fidelity, while JEPQ is a Nasdaq-100 fund tracking the Nasdaq-100 Index. FBND is actively managed, while JEPQ is passively managed. Over the past 3 years, FBND returned 4.60%/yr vs 20.04%/yr for JEPQ. At a 0.23 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. FBND charges 0.36%/yr vs 0.35%/yr for JEPQ.

Drawdowns
FBND vs. JEPQ -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um FBND drawdown since its inception was -17.25%, smaller than the maximum JEPQ drawdown of -20.07%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for FBND and JEPQ.

Volatility
FBND vs. JEPQ -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for Fidelity Total Bond ETF (FBND) is 1.23%, while JPMorgan Nasdaq Equity Premium Income ETF (JEPQ) has a volatility of 3.65%. This indicates that FBND exper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than JEPQ based on this measure.
